/// Exit early from a loop.
///
/// The documentation for this keyword is [not yet complete]. Pull requests welcome!
/// When `break` is encountered, execution of the associated loop body is
/// immediately terminated.
///
/// ```rust
/// let mut last = 0;
///
/// for x in 1..100 {
/// if x > 12 {
/// break;
/// }
/// last = x;
/// }
///
/// assert_eq!(last, 12);
/// println!("{}", last);
/// ```
///
/// A break expression is normally associated with the innermost loop enclosing the
/// `break` but a label can be used to specify which enclosing loop is affected.
///
///```rust
/// 'outer: for i in 1..=5 {
/// println!("outer iteration (i): {}", i);
///
/// 'inner: for j in 1..=200 {
/// println!(" inner iteration (j): {}", j);
/// if j >= 3 {
/// // breaks from inner loop, let's outer loop continue.
/// break;
/// }
/// if i >= 2 {
/// // breaks from outer loop, and directly to "Bye".
/// break 'outer;
/// }
/// }
/// }
/// println!("Bye.");
///```
///
/// When associated with `loop`, a break expression may be used to return a value from that loop.
/// This is only valid with `loop` and not with any other type of loop.
/// If no value is specified, `break;` returns `()`.
/// Every `break` within a loop must return the same type.
///
/// ```rust
/// let (mut a, mut b) = (1, 1);
/// let result = loop {
/// if b > 10 {
/// break b;
/// }
/// let c = a + b;
/// a = b;
/// b = c;
/// };
/// // first number in Fibonacci sequence over 10:
/// assert_eq!(result, 13);
/// println!("{}", result);
/// ```
///
/// For more details consult the [Reference on "break expression"] and the [Reference on "break and
/// loop values"].
///
/// [Reference on "break expression"]: ../reference/expressions/loop-expr.html#break-expressions
/// [Reference on "break and loop values"]:
/// ../reference/expressions/loop-expr.html#break-and-loop-values
///
